Mount St. Joe psychologist creates innovative schizophrenia project

For the past three years, on their own time and with no outside money, Dr. Lynda Crane and a fellow Mount St. Joseph psychologist, Tracy McDonough, have built the Schizophrenia Oral History Project. Other oral history collections have focused on diseases like AIDS or leprosy, but this is the first to focus on schizophrenia, they say. Read more.
